About the Role

We are looking for a talented and driven Applications Engineer to help our customers deploy and optimize their software on our new accelerated computing platform. In this high-impact role, you will be a key technical resource, applying your programming and performance tuning skills to a wide range of cutting-edge HPC-AI workloads.

Responsibilities

  • Assist customers in deploying and optimizing their software applications and libraries to our revolutionary Thunderbird accelerated computing platform.
  • Profile and identify bottlenecks in a range of HPC-AI applications.
  • Implement creative algorithmic and software solutions to solve bottlenecks and accelerate software on the Thunderbird platform.
  • Help translate application performance issues and requirements into actionable feedback for software features and hardware teams.
  • Assist in creating demos, application notes, and other technical documentation to help speed customer adoption.
  • Support the development of performance models for future generations of accelerated computing architectures.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or a related field.
  • Minimum of 3 years of hands-on experience with development in one or more HPC-AI application domains.
  • Excellent C/C++ programming skills.
  • Working knowledge of Linux.
  • Ability to measure and profile HPC-AI application-level performance at the node level.
  • Working understanding of OpenMP, MPI, or related parallel programming models.
  • Strong problem-solving abilities with the ability to analyze complex data and attention to detail.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to present technical information clearly to technical stakeholders.
  • Willingness to travel as necessary.
  • Ability to work independently in a fast-paced environment.
  • Experience with competitive performance analysis.
  • Experience with graph analytics or other compute-intensive workloads.

About the Company

  • InspireSemi is revolutionizing high-performance computing with a groundbreaking architecture that packs thousands of 64-bit CPU cores onto a single chip.
  • Our mission is to make high performance computing more accessible, energy-efficient, and easier for developers to harness.
